Crontab

Résolu
Devael12 Messages postés 12 Date d'inscription   Statut Membre Dernière intervention   -  
Devael12 Messages postés 12 Date d'inscription   Statut Membre Dernière intervention   -
Bonjour,


Quelqu'un pourrait m'aider je désire faire une tâche planifiée avec crontab mais je n'arrive pas à trouver la syntaxe me permettant d'exclure seulement deux journées dans le mois peu importele jour de la semaine

si quelqu'un a une idée ce serait très gentil merci!

4 réponses

roussos Messages postés 221 Date d'inscription   Statut Membre Dernière intervention   8
 
Bonjour,
Si tu veux juste enlever deux jours dans le mois, tu devras énumérer tous les jours exceptés les jours à ne pas mettre:

donc ta syntaxe peut être la suivante

min heure 1,2,3,4,6,8,9,11 mois semaine

Bon courage.
0
Devael12 Messages postés 12 Date d'inscription   Statut Membre Dernière intervention   1
 
Super! merci beaucoup!

Tout en l'écrivant tout à l'heure je me suis demandé si ça fonctionnerais si je l'écrivais ainsi : min heure 1-9, 11-19,21-30 mois semaine

est ce que la combinaison peut causer problème?

merci pour l'aide
0
roussos Messages postés 221 Date d'inscription   Statut Membre Dernière intervention   8
 
Les valeurs avec les tirets représentes des périodes, maintenant ce qui reste à savoir si on peut associer les périodes. Cela je ne sais pas si je trouves je te tiens informé.

0
zipe31 Messages postés 36402 Date d'inscription   Statut Contributeur Dernière intervention   6 429
 
Salut,

Extrait du man 5 crontab :

Les listes sont permises. Une liste est un ensemble de nombres ou d'intervalles  séparés  par des virgules. Exemple « 1,2,5,9 », « 0-4,8-12 ».
0
Devael12 Messages postés 12 Date d'inscription   Statut Membre Dernière intervention   1
 
Merci beaucoup ca fonctionne tres bien!
0